At its core, Drawing: Saikyou Mangaka wa Oekaki Skill de Isekai Musou Suru! is a story about redemption and the quest for a meaningful life. The narrative follows Akira Kamishiro, an immensely successful manga author at the pinnacle of his career. However, his life is turned upside down when he is diagnosed with blood cancer. This grim prognosis forces him to reflect on his existence, leading to a profound realization of regret.
